Inclusive Football at Brackley Town FC

Northamptonshire FA has recently been supporting one of our local football clubs, Brackley Town, to establish their first disability-specific opportunity for adults and young people aged 16+ with disabilities, impairments, or other additional needs.

Starting next Friday (10th April), sessions are focused on fun, accessibility, and inclusivity, ensuring that players have the opportunity to play, be active, and socialise in a friendly and welcoming environment – whether they are an experienced player or completely new to the game!

The club is really keen to make this a success, and want to engage as many people and communities as possible to ensure that anyone who may find this session meets their needs, is aware of it and has the opportunity to give it a go!

When? Fridays 5:30pm to 6:30pm (starting 10th April)
Who can join? Adults and young people aged 16+ with special educational needs, disabilities, or other impairments, health conditions, or support needs
Where? Brackley Town Football Club, Churchill Way, Brackley, NN13 7EJ

  • Sessions are welcoming, accessible, and inclusive. All abilities welcome!
  • Delivered by passionate, supportive coaches, sessions are shaped around the needs of players.
  • Low-commitment, non-competitive, and focused on FUN!
  • Meet new people, build friendships, improve physical and mental health, and enjoy being active in a positive team environment.
